
As we look ahead to 2023, there are several emerging trends in commercial real estate that investors and business owners should be paying attention to. From technology advancements to changing demographics, here are the top commercial real estate trends to watch:
The Rise of Smart Buildings: The Internet of Things (IoT) has made it possible for buildings to be equipped with sensors, automation, and real-time data collection. Smart buildings will be able to optimize energy usage, improve tenant comfort and safety, and reduce maintenance costs.
Co-Working Spaces: The rise of remote work and the gig economy has led to an increased demand for flexible office space. Co-working spaces provide a shared office environment where professionals can work independently, collaborate with others, and have access to amenities such as conference rooms and high-speed internet.
Sustainability: With growing concerns about climate change, sustainability has become a top priority for many businesses and investors. Commercial real estate properties that are designed to be energy-efficient and environmentally friendly are becoming increasingly attractive to tenants and investors.
Demographic Shifts: As baby boomers retire and younger generations enter the workforce, there will be a shift in demand for different types of commercial real estate. For example, millennials may prefer urban, walkable locations with access to public transportation, while baby boomers may prefer suburban locations with ample parking.
By staying informed about these emerging trends in commercial real estate, investors and business owners can make informed decisions about their investments and operations. Keep an eye on these trends and stay ahead of the curve in 2023.
